## Sensor drift: what to do at 3am

If the GrowLoop controller starts reporting humidity swings that don't match the backup probes in the Fernwick greenhouse, it's almost always sensor drift, not an actual climate event. Don't panic and don't touch the vents manually. First, restart the calibration daemon and give it ten minutes to re-baseline. If readings still disagree by more than 5%, flip the controller into safe mode. The safe-mode thresholds it will use are these.

config for yahap-bajof:
[istix]
host = istix.qorvelsys.internal
user = istix_svc
database = istix_prod

For anyone new to the Marlowick handlers: the cold-start cost here comes mostly from eagerly loading the Fennport schema cache in the module scope. Please keep heavyweight imports inside the handler unless they're needed on every invocation, since our scale-to-zero policy means cold starts dominate p99 latency. I'd suggest we gate the prewarm behavior on the constants below, which I've tuned against staging traffic.

tuning constants:
BUDGETS = {
    "druath": 240,
    "lamwyn": 180,
    "silael": 275,
}

# Runbook — Carving the user module out of Bramblecore

Okay, step four of the split: once the new Userhive service is deployed, flip the traffic weight to 10% and watch the auth error dashboard for twenty minutes. If it's quiet, ramp to 50%. The monolith keeps serving writes until step six, so don't panic about drift yet. Before you can publish the Userhive release artifact, you'll need the deploy key, which is below.

rollout seal: bky9_PeXH1fTLY